This paper presents architecture and simulation results of the analog part of a multichannel integrated circuit (IC) for optical radiation sensors (visible and infrared light) that can be used in high-speed applications. The complete prototype, called Optical Radiation Readout Circuit (ORRC) is composed of analog front end and moderate-resolution analog-to-digital converter (ADC) included in every...
The paper presents an optimized architecture of cascaded integrator-comb (CIC) digital filter structure. The structure is suitable for implementation in application specific integration circuits (ASICs) or field programmable gate arrays (FPGAs). The main advantages of the architecture are higher working frequency, smaller area size and lower power consumption. Software in C++ language was written...
In this paper we present a measurement system for multichannel recordings of the electrophysiological activity of brain tissue in vivo. The system consists of: penetrating Microelectrode Array (MEA), three versions of a Conditioning Module each equipped with different Application Specific Integrated Circuits (ASIC's), Digitizer and PC Application for recorded data presentation and storage.
